The company most recently announced Oct. 17 that AVG Anti-Virus has become the most popular program on  &lt;a href="http://Download.com"&gt;Download.com&lt;/a&gt;, one of the Internet's largest software sites, with more than 41 million downloads.&lt;br&gt;But popularity doesn't always lead to profit, and Grisoft is looking to convert the goodwill it is banking into future paying customers, says  J.R. Smith, the company's chief executive officer.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;"We see [the free version] as a form of marketing," he says. "It's extremely viral — the upkeep costs are made up by the word-of-mouth it gets us."&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Computer security is a burgeoning field, its growth hastened by the multitude of pitfalls coming from increased Internet dependence. Beyond viruses, there are programs devoted to filtering junk mail, blocking fake Web sites used to steal bank information and establishing firewalls to prevent hackers from taking over a computer's controls.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Despite this variety, a large part of the security market remains in the hands of two American companies, McAfee and Symantec, says Ruggero Contu, a security analyst at the IT research firm Gartner. In particular, these companies dominate large-scale computer networks, including big business and education.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Companies like Grisoft must instead find room to grow in the consumer market, Smith says. For example, spreading the AVG name has led to two million paid downloads of its deluxe antivirus program, called AVG Anti-Virus Pro, which retails for $38.95 (750 Kč). &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Grisoft gets most of its revenue from the UK and the United States, Smith says. Part of this localized success is purely a matter of language, as AVG's free version comes only in English, though the company promises more languages in the future, including the recent launch of a Japanese version.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Another growth strategy employed by small vendors is selling their products directly to Internet service providers, which then pipe the program to their customers, according to Contu.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;"This has become a good way to do business," he says. "This is giving smaller vendors a good way to prove the effectiveness of their technology, a better opportunity to compete with the establishment." &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Grisoft will be following a similar tack, says Smith. He joined the company earlier this year, lured by the firm's new majority owners, Enterprise Investors and Intel Capital, which bought 65 percent of the company in 2005 for $52 million.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Viral evolution&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;The causes and actors behind Internet attacks have changed since the early part of this decade, according to Karel Obluk, Grisoft's chief technology officer.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;"Viruses are not about ego anymore," he says. "Virus makers don't look to create huge slowdowns or wipe hard drives. They're trying to make money. They may limit the virus to taking over 5,000 computers to extract information or set up 'bot nets' to attack companies or mail spam." &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;By limiting the number of infected computers, viruses become harder to identify and stop. And if that's not bad enough, malicious coders have also developed techniques that allow viruses to be polymorphic, meaning that the viruses subtly evolve when they replicate, doubly complicating tracking.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Many of these viruses and attacks come out of the former Soviet Union, Smith says, where organized crime has set up programming divisions that mirror the capabilities and organization of legitimate software companies in the West. These programs are then sold to the highest bidder.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;The complexity of threats has prompted Internet security companies, including Grisoft, to offer integrated software.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;"All of the major players have been working toward offering suites," Contu says. But "it's not just a matter of adding up these layers and you'll be successful. You must be able to integrate these different layers and make sure you don't have false positives." &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;That's the difficult path Grisoft has to cut, Smith says. While everyone wants to avoid the mountains of spam avalanching into their inboxes, should a program flag one important letter as junk the user will caterwaul —regardless of how many other threats have been prevented.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;"There's always a risk of false positives," he says. "Engineers have to walk a fine line between accurately marking spam and not misidentifying important information. Consumers will only tolerate so many mistakes." &lt;br&gt;And what about computer users who decide to go it alone, trusting their own surfing savvy? While it may remain possible to stay virus free, the threats will only continue to multiply.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;For one example, look to Estonia, a country advanced in its Internet use — it has even held national elections over the Web. This May, anonymous hackers brought the country's infrastructure to its knees, crippling many essential services, Obluk points out.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;"It was an organized attack," he says. "It was a demonstration of what can be done to a country. All they have to do is look at an on-screen keyboard--and blink. &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;The software, which was released free of charge, is the brainchild of Kohei Arai, a professor of advanced information processing at Saga University. By the end of August, 248 people had downloaded the software, named &amp;quot;Mitsumeru Dake&amp;quot; (Just Look). &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;Needless to say, the people the software targets are extremely grateful. &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;&amp;quot;I&amp;#39;m told that the ability to see is the last function ALS patients like me can retain. I&amp;#39;m sure I&amp;#39;ll be able to continue using a computer thanks to your software,&amp;quot; one user wrote to Arai. ALS is amyotrophic lateral sclerosis, a progressive and neurodegenerative disease better known as Lou Gehrig&amp;#39;s disease. &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;According to Arai, it works like this: &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;-- Look at one of 15 on-screen buttons for one second and blink. The computer recognizes three points of an eye--the inner corner of the eye, the inner extremity of the eyebrow and the center of the pupil--for permanent registration with the help of a Web camera attached to the computer. Repeat the same process with the remaining on-screen buttons. &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;-- Ten hiragana characters--a, ka, sa, ta, na, ha, ma, ya, ra, wa--and five function keys, such as the &amp;quot;enter&amp;quot; key, appear on the screen. &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;-- When a user wants to input &amp;quot;u&amp;quot; in hiragana, for example, gaze at the &amp;quot;a&amp;quot; character for one second and blink. The computer then shows the &amp;quot;a&amp;quot; column of the kana syllabary--a, i, u, e and o. Look at &amp;quot;u&amp;quot; for one second and blink, and the &amp;quot;u&amp;quot; character will be displayed. &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;-- Gaze at one of the on-screen function keys and blink to convert hiragana characters to kanji. &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;The software can be used with a Web camera that creates images with a resolution of 300,000 pixels or more. The cameras are available for several thousand yen. &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;Arai said the idea for the software sprang to mind in 2001, when a heavily physically disabled student was admitted to Saga University. InstallAware is the only commercial installation toolkit at this time to expose the new features available in Windows Installer 4.5, ahead of other competitors such as InstallShield.  &lt;p&gt;&amp;quot;We have once again demonstrated our commitment to developers by beating all other vendors to providing native Windows Installer 4.5 support,&amp;quot; says Sinan Karaca, Founder of InstallAware Software Corporation. &amp;quot;All our current users may immediately download the free plug-in update pack from our website -- without having to pay for or wait an extensive amount of time for a vital update like this.&amp;quot; &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;Windows Installer 4.5 introduces major new features for application deployment, such as chaining multiple setup packages together. Multiple chained packages can be installed in a single, atomic transaction that can be rolled back if an error occurs in any one of the chained packages, or the end-user decides to abort the installation. This helps make application installations more robust, especially when most applications today have dependencies on component and technology frameworks. All .NET applications, for instance, require the installation of the Microsoft .NET Framework; which can now be installed together with your applications in a transactional, atomic way. &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;&amp;quot;Microsoft selected InstallAware as a launch partner on their first-ever coupled beta program for Windows Installer,&amp;quot; says Panagiotis Kefalidis, Developer Evangelist at InstallAware Software Corporation. &amp;quot;We are proud to be working together with Microsoft in delivering our customer base the latest innovations in technology at breakneck speed.&amp;quot;&lt;br&gt; &am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&lt;br&gt; Even without the Windows Installer 4.5 update, developers can already chain multiple packages together using InstallAware&amp;#39;s advanced setup bootstrapping capabilities. InstallAware&amp;#39;s advanced bootstrapper captures the actual installation progress of each chained package and displays it natively in your own setup wizard, dramatically improving the end-user experience, and impressing your brand throughout the entire duration of your application&amp;#39;s setup -- even during the installation of its pre-requisites, such as the .NET Framework. InstallAware&amp;#39;s advanced bootstrapper also pre-populates third-party package options as necessary -- instead of requiring end-users to manually populate configuration settings inside separate third-party installation windows -- eliminating yet another potential point of failure in your installations, which in turn helps reduce your support and maintenance costs. &l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;It is not necessary to overhaul existing InstallAware projects to take advantage of Windows Installer 4.5 features. It literally takes two lines of InstallAware code -- one to begin a transaction, and the other to end the ongoing transaction -- to create atomic, transactional installation regions directly within existing setup projects. Absolutely no setup re-engineering is required.
